Board of Nursing
Rule Submittal Date
On November 30, 2000, the Board of Nursing submitted a proposed rule to the Legislative Council Rules Clearinghouse.
Analysis
The proposed rule-making order relates to defining the practice of nursing to include acting under the direction of optometrists.
Agency Procedure for Promulgation
A public hearing is required and will be held on January 4, 2001 at 8:30 a.m. in Room 179A.

N o t i c e s
Notice of Hearing
Financial Institutions—Banking
Pursuant to s. 227.17, Stats., notice is hereby given that the Department of Financial Institutions, Division of Banking will hold a public hearing at the time and place indicated below to consider repealing certain requirements that the name and location of a bank be on bank checks.

Text of the Proposed Rule
SECTION 1. Section DFI-Bkg 8.04 is repealed.
Reference to Statutory Authority and Analysis Prepared by Department of Financial Institutions, Division of Banking
Analysis: To repeal s. DFI-Bkg 8.04. Statutory authority: Sections 220.02 (2) and 227.11 (2), Stats. Summary: Section DFI-Bkg 8.04 requires that the name and location of a bank home office shall be stated on all bank checks, and that the name of a bank branch may be stated on bank checks. State law on negotiable instruments, Uniform Commercial Code s. 403.104, Stats., does not require this information. Federal law on presentment and issuance of checks, 12 CFR 229.36, does not require this information. However, practically a check, both as a negotiable instrument and in the course of presentment, will contain bank identification information. Section DFI-Bkg 8.04 is, therefore, both unnecessary and redundant.
